Anna Blatz, 87
Born: Sept. 10, 1924
Died: April 8, 2012

Anna Kathryn “Kay” Blatz, 87 years, formerly of Bedford, Ky., died at 12:45 p.m. Easter Sunday, April 8, 2012, at Riveridge Manor in Niles following an extended illness.

She was born Sept. 10, 1924, in Sulphur, Ky., to Joe Thomas and Anna Lou (Lynch) Louden. She graduated from Henry County (Kentucky) High School, and lived in Bedford until coming to Niles in 2010. She was employed in Bedford area taverns.

Kay was a member of the auxiliaries to the VFW and the DAV in Bedford, and the Bedford chapter of the Order of the Eastern Star. She enjoyed playing cards and visiting with folks.

She was first married to Floyd Bauman, and later to Bama Langley, before her marriage to Louie Blatz, all of whom preceded her in death. She was also preceded in death by a daughter, Shirley Robinson; a grandson, Scott Seidner; and by brothers, James, Morris and Edward Louden.

Surviving family includes her son, Richard Bauman of Campbellsburg, Ky.; her daughter, Clara (Dave) Singleton of Niles; grandchildren, Lorrie Kinkade, Michelle Cook, Tammy Kennedy, Richard Seidner, Dawn Van Dyke and Robert Seidner; great-grandchildren, Ashley Croucher, Jennifer Sturgis, Trey Horner, Kyle Horner, Jacob Van Dyke, Taya Seidner and Kahlyn Seidner; and several nieces and nephews.

The family of Kay Blatz will be gathering privately for services, and for burial at the Sulphur (Kentucky) Cemetery.

Contributions in memory of Kay may be made to the Susan G. Komen for the Cure, or to a hospice of the donor’s choice.

Arrangements were made at the Halbritter Funeral Home, Niles.
